Robert Dekle

I am Professor of Economics at the University of Southern California. My areas of research specialization are international finance and open economy macroeconomics, especially of the Emerging Markets of East Asia, and the Japanese Economy. In addition to academia, I have extensive experience in government (Federal Reserve Board of Governors, Federal Reserve Bank of New York) and in international organizations (International Monetary Fund). At USC, I teach courses in undergraduate macroeconomics and graduate international finance.
